FusionCharts v3 比以前的版本拥有大量的新的 功能。下面列出的是其中的几个主要的:
v3.1的更新:
在客户端、服务器端导出图表为PDF和图像
旋转的文本不需要嵌入字体了。任何UTF - 8字符现在可以旋转。使FusionCharts真正的多语言使用。
选项指定文本值,可以取代那些图表上显示每个数据项的数值
能在图表预定义位置加载自定义标志,然后链接相同的地方
能在图表的上下文菜单中增加自定义菜单,然后链接相同的地方
支持标题,子标题和工具提示
趋势线现在可以自定义工具文本
用户课对数据项定义调色板
更多的JavaScript事件,以帮助您通过JavaScript更好的操纵图表
能使用上下文菜单或者JavaScript 导出数据到csv
能通过JavaScript API从任何图表获取XML数据
能通过JavaScript API获取图表属性
图表已经在36fps重新编辑以解决firefox内存问题
v3.0的更新?
新的图表类型
FusionCharts v3 引入了很多新的图表类型,如:
滚动图表 - 2D柱状图, 2D折线图和2D面积图, 叠加2D柱状图, 组合2D图, 组合2D (双Y)图
条形图
条形面积图
对数数轴图表
2D多图单Y组合图表
2D多图双Y组合图表. 此种图表能绘制出9种类型图表:
柱状图 (主Y) + 折线图 (次Y) 组合图
柱状图 (主Y) + 面积图 (次Y) 组合图
柱状图 (主Y) + 柱状图 (次Y) 组合图
面积图 (主Y) + 折线图 (次Y) 组合图
面积图 (主Y) + 柱状图 (次Y) 组合图
面积图 (主Y) + 面积图 (次Y) 组合图
折线图 (主Y) + 折线图 (次Y) 组合图
折线图 (主Y) + 柱状图 (次Y) 组合图
折线图 (主Y) + 面积图 (次Y) 组合图
3D叠加柱状折线双Y组合图表
3D横向条形图
3D叠加条形图
高级的蜡烛棒图表支持折线、条形和柱状图
为高级的模拟场景设计的可拖动的柱状图
瀑布图
上述所列图表有很少一部分不在标准的FusionCharts包中,比如齿轮、对数图、瀑布图和可拖动的图表在 PowerCharts包中,可单独购买..
能导出图表为图像
从FusionCharts v3.0.5开始, 你现在可以导出使用客户端和服务器端操作的组合图片的图表.
容易,但先进的与JavaScript整合
FusionCharts v3提供先进的解决方案来完善使用Ajax应用或Javascript模块创建图表。你可以更新客户端图表,调用Javascript函数作为热点链接,或在不调用任何页面刷新的情况下动态调用XML数据。你还可以指定为每个图表指定一个特殊的DOMId并将它与JavaScript登记。图表能保持Javascript函数发布后的活动。
可视化的XML生成工具
FusionCharts v3 引入了一种新的视觉XML和图表生成工具,帮助您轻松地建立您的XML数据的图表。您可以手动输入数据,形成一个网格XML或转换成您现有的从 CSV文件、表格、电子表格数据到XML数据。
样式元素
FusionCharts v3 引入样式来帮助你应用字体,效果和动画,以图表的各种对象。样式给你一个简单的机制,利用它您可以轻松地控制图表可视化布局
地图支持
FusionCharts v3 在PowerMaps包中引入地图。该PowerMaps包是一个基于61种flash矢量来显示相关的地理分区数据的不同类型的地图的集合。在网站和应用程序中使用是非常合适的。每个地图使用一个XML API来扩展其性能。设置使用地图仅需要几分钟的时间,不涉及任何源代码的修改。所有您做的是在XML文件中提供数据就可以了。
使用Adobe Flash 8通过ActionScript 2来创建
FusionCharts v3 是使用Flash 8和ActionScript 2来编码的。它充分利用了Flash 8的先进的性能如动态补偿、过滤器、更好的速度、面向对象编程等 .
新的调试模式
FusionCharts v3 为每个图表启用了调试模式。调试模式帮助你寻找在场景后的图表到底发生了什么。你可以看到图表是如何初始化、使用Javascript交互获取数据、产生的各种错误也显示在这里。因此,无论合适你的图表出现错误,你需要做的是切换到调试模式并且修复它。
梯度支持
FusionCharts v3 支持为图表的很多对象如背景、帆布、数据图等提供渐变。很多新的图表支持单一属性 use3DLighting ,使用先进的灯光,在图表上实现梯度效应以获得更好的视觉效果。
调色板支持
FusionCharts v3 提供了调色板以帮助您快速选择图表的颜色主题。从V3开始,你可以选择5个预先定义的调色板,改变你的图表的外观。在使用调色板时你不需要指定任何十六进制的颜色代码 。
虚线支持
从FusionCharts v3,你可以使用虚线绘制:
数据 (柱状图, 折线图, 饼图等.)
网格分区折线图
趋势折线图
垂直分割折线图
你还可以指定虚线的属性比如长度、间隔等
数据标签的多显示模式
在FusionCharts v3, 有很多的选择,允许引进更好的X轴标签控制。现在,您可以收起,错开或旋转 X轴的标签。
旋转值框及动态位置选项
数据值的文本字段,现在可以旋转,以避免杂乱。 此外,在柱形图情况下,可以选择是否放置 内部或外部的列值文本框。如果没有空间, FusionCharts v3的会自动调整位置.
数字缩放比例支持
FusionCharts v3 采用数字缩放比例以更好地控制数字缩放格式.
自动分区折线图编号
FusionCharts v3采用自动分区折线图编号,在图表中放置最佳的位置
更好的打印支持
图表的上下文菜单现在包括一个新的项目“打印图表”,提供标准的垮浏览器打印支持。
更好地控制动态调整大小
v3 采用两种图表大小调整模式-exactFit和noScale。noScale使用基于像素的大小控制。exactFit模式,可以按百分比调整图表大小。此外,exactFit模式当容器对象(浏览器、表、DIV等)允许动态缩放。
先进的饼图和圆环图
FusionCharts v3 的饼图和甜甜圈图向最终用户提供像动态切片、旋转、链接等交互性选项,除此之外,智能标签已被引入饼图和甜甜圈图。
更好的说明
FusionCharts v3 为多系列/组合图表采用更好的和前瞻性说明。你可以为每个图表的很多属性自定义说明。
高级钻取功能
图表项目现在可以链接到新窗口,弹出式,框架或自窗口。
任何两个数据点之间的垂直分工线
在基于轴的图表,你现在可以选择任何两个数据之间的垂直分工线。这特别有助于当你绘制的2年的数据,你想在图表之间两年的数据分隔。
整个图表作为一个热点
从v3开始,整个图表现在可以作为一个单一的热点.
自定义的每个数据项的工具提示
现在,您可以为每个数据项设计您自己的工具提示文本
应用程序消息的多语言支持
现在,您可以轻松地自定义图表显示应用程序的消息 (加载图表,装载数据,绘制图表等。)用你自己的 语言。为此,你需要指定的消息来源的图表 并重新编译
分享到:
相关推荐
通过深入研究这些实例,你可以掌握如何在实际项目中有效地使用FusionCharts,从创建基本图表到实现高级特性,如数据动态更新、交互控制和导出功能。同时,也可以结合FusionCharts的官方文档和社区资源,进一步提升你...
FusionCharts 3.1版本增加了许多新特性和改进,包括性能优化、新的图表类型和API接口。学习FusionCharts 3.1教程可以帮助开发者了解如何配置和使用这些新功能,包括: 1. **安装与引入**:学习如何在项目中引入...
此外,FusionCharts XT(扩展版)提供了更多的特性,如地图、3D图表、甘特图等,能满足更专业的需求。 总之,“FusionChart报表demo”是一个很好的学习资源,它可以帮助我们了解如何使用FusionCharts创建动态、富有...
2. **跨浏览器兼容性**:FusionChart V3利用JavaScript的跨平台特性,支持多种主流浏览器,包括Internet Explorer、Firefox、Chrome、Safari等,确保了广泛的用户覆盖。 3. **动画效果**:通过JavaScript,...
一、FusionChart的核心特性 1. **多样化图表类型**:FusionChart支持超过90种不同类型的图表,包括柱状图、饼图、线图、雷达图、热力图等,满足各类数据分析和展示需求。 2. **实时更新**:FusionChart能够实现...
而"**FusionCharts参数大全+中文说明.pdf**"则是深入理解图表特性的关键;最后,"**FusionCharts_free_中文开发指南.pdf**"则提供了一套完整的开发流程和技巧,是快速提升技能的宝贵资料。 总之,这个压缩包为...
商业版本的FusionCharts不仅提供了基本的图表展示,还包含了一系列高级特性,如自定义主题、实时数据更新、多语言支持等,旨在满足企业级用户的需求。 在Flex版本的FusionCharts中,它利用Adobe Flex技术进行开发,...
FusionCharts提供了丰富的交互特性,如图例点击、钻取、工具提示等。例如,可以通过`setXMLData()`方法改变数据源来实现图例点击时数据的切换。 8. **图表类型** FusionCharts支持多种图表类型,如柱状图、饼图、...
FusionCharts的核心特性包括: 1. **无需额外插件**:FusionCharts不需要用户在客户端安装任何Active-X或扩展控件,只需在服务器上上传核心的SWF文件,并配置相应的XML数据文件。 2. **生动的视觉效果**:它能生成...
这个名为“Fusionchart 包”的压缩文件包含了FusionCharts XT的评估版,允许用户在自己的项目中试用其功能,以决定是否进行商业应用。 FusionCharts XT的核心特性包括: 1. **丰富的图表类型**:它提供了超过90种...
它的核心特性包括布局管理、数据绑定、组件化UI元素以及强大的表单处理能力。通过使用MVC(Model-View-Controller)架构,开发者可以更高效地组织代码并实现模块化。 2. **FusionCharts XT简介**: FusionCharts ...
在这个"fusionchart 小例子 Java+Servlet"项目中,我们将探讨如何结合Java后端技术和Servlet来实现FusionCharts的功能。 首先,`Java`是一种广泛使用的后端编程语言,它提供了强大的功能来处理数据和业务逻辑。在这...
每个FusionChart实例都需要一个唯一的ID,这由`chart.id`属性指定。在HTML中,这个ID对应于图表的容器元素。 3. **数据源(Data Source)** 数据源可以是JSON字符串或XML字符串,也可以是从服务器获取的数据。`...
FusionCharts是一款强大的JavaScript图表库,它提供了丰富的图表类型,如饼图、折线图、柱状图等,用于...这个例子是一个很好的起点,通过实践和探索,你可以掌握更多FusionCharts的高级特性,提升你的数据可视化技能。
集成后,用户可以利用FusionCharts的交互特性,如点击图表元素获取详细信息、缩放图表、动态加载数据等,提升应用的交互性和用户友好性。 6. **优化与注意事项**: - 考虑性能优化,如延迟加载图表,只在需要时...
JSON(JavaScript Object Notation)是一种轻量级的数据交换格式,因其简洁、易读且易于解析的特性,常用于数据传输。在FusionCharts中,我们可以通过JSON格式来传递数据,以便于图表的渲染。 实现FusionCharts与...
3D 特性 - **slicingDistance**: 设置点击饼块时该饼块与中心的距离。 - **pieRadius**: 设置饼图的外半径。 - **startingAngle**: 设置饼图的起始角度。 - **enableRotation**: 是否允许旋转饼图。 - **...
FusionCharts是一款强大...其跨平台、跨浏览器的特性,以及对多种编程语言的支持,使之成为一款广泛使用的图表解决方案。通过阅读和实践本手册,开发者可以快速掌握FusionCharts的使用方法,创建出专业且吸引人的图表。
虽然这两家公司都有相似的产品和目标市场,但在具体的产品特性和使用上存在一些差异。 Anychart是由Anychart.com开发的,公司总部位于北美,研发团队在俄罗斯。它的主要产品包括AnyChart(基础图表、仪表盘、...